Quick and Easy Dinner Ideas
Here are some light and flavorful dinner recipes for busy weeknights that you can whip up in no time:
1. Lemon Herb Grilled Chicken
This dish is a fantastic way to infuse flavor into your protein while keeping it light. Marinate chicken breasts in l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, and fresh herbs for at least 30 minutes. Grill them for about 6-7 minutes on each side, and serve with a side of steamed vegetables or a fresh salad.
2. Quinoa and Black Bean Salad
Quinoa is a great source of protein and fiber, making it an excellent base for a quick salad. Combine cooked quinoa with black beans, diced bell peppers, corn, and avocado. Drizzle with lime juice and a sprinkle of cumin for an extra kick. This salad can be made in advance and stored in the fridge for a quick meal.
3. Shrimp Stir-Fry
Stir-fries are perfect for busy weeknights because they cook quickly and can be customized with your favorite vegetables. Sauté shrimp in a bit of sesame oil, add broccoli, bell peppers, and snap peas, and toss everything with soy sauce and ginger. Serve over brown rice or cauliflower rice for a light meal.
4. Veggie-Packed Omelette
Omelettes are not just for breakfast! Whip up a quick omelette filled with spinach, tomatoes, and feta cheese for a nutritious dinner option. Pair it with whole-grain toast for a complete meal.
5. Zucchini Noodles with Pesto
For a low-carb alternative to pasta, try zucchini noodles. Spiralize fresh zucchini and toss it with homemade or store-bought pesto. Add cherry tomatoes and grilled chicken for a satisfying dish that’s ready in minutes.
Meal Prep Tips for Busy Weeknights
To make your weeknight dinners even easier, consider these meal prep tips:
- Plan your meals in advance to avoid last-minute decisions.
- Prepare ingredients ahead of time, such as chopping vegetables or marinating proteins.
- Cook in batches and store leftovers for quick reheating.
- Invest in quality storage containers to keep your meals fresh.
Frequently Asked Questions
What are some other quick dinner ideas?
Other quick dinner ideas include tacos with lean ground turkey, baked salmon with asparagus, and vegetable stir-fry with tofu.
Can I make these recipes ahead of time?
Yes! Many of these recipes can be made ahead of time and stored in the refrigerator for easy reheating during the week.
